Bitcoin has recently dipped below the $60,000 mark, prompting analysts like 21Shares to reaffirm that its anticipated break from the four-year market cycle has not materialized. This trend carries implications for investors and market analysts alike, emphasizing the cyclical nature of cryptocurrencies even as they gain mainstream acceptance.

Bitcoin's price movements are often analyzed through its historical cycles, which span approximately four years, typically marked by periods of rapid growth followed by corrections. The underlying factors include halving events, which reduce the rate at which new coins are mined, and increased institutional adoption. The latest dip under $60,000 highlights the resistance to breaking this pattern, suggesting market sentiments remain tethered to historical precedents rather than a new trajectory of growth.

In the broader cryptocurrency sector, Bitcoin's price dynamics influence a host of altcoins and the overall market sentiment. Despite occasional bullish trends, many cryptocurrencies are still closely correlated with Bitcoin's performance. Recent data indicates that the total market capitalization of cryptocurrencies has fluctuated significantly in tandem with Bitcoin's pricing, underscoring its role as a bellwether for the entire industry.

In India, the impact of Bitcoin's fluctuating price is significant for various stakeholders, including crypto exchanges like WazirX and CoinDCX, which have seen varying trading volumes based on Bitcoin's performance. Additionally, Indian developers and startups in blockchain technology are closely monitoring these trends, as they align their projects with market cycles in hopes of maximizing investment returns during bullish periods.
